Output 80ea2f23fc0c5536b0c62192e7a92cea79f15e0cc8c7129ddcd250ea0cd9e1b6:0

value
287093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c191125e65b5a0a7a45662cce06bba12e8965b78 OP_EQUAL
address
3KLW8L3S1ZZkdpvZk8D1oZ7FeyYqCgWzvK
transaction
80ea2f23fc0c5536b0c62192e7a92cea79f15e0cc8c7129ddcd250ea0cd9e1b6
spent
true